RNA polymerase I and III subunit C
Summary
RNA polymerase I and III subunit C is a protein[1].

- RNA polymerase I and III subunit C's molecular function is recorded as DNA binding[16].
- RNA polymerase I and III subunit C's molecular function is recorded as protein dimerization activity[17].
- RNA polymerase I and III subunit C's molecular function is recorded as RNA polymerase III activity[18].
- RNA polymerase I and III subunit C's molecular function is recorded as DNA-directed 5'-3' RNA polymerase activity[19].
- RNA polymerase I and III subunit C's molecular function is recorded as protein binding[20].
- RNA polymerase I and III subunit C's molecular function is recorded as RNA polymerase I activity[21].
- RNA polymerase I and III subunit C's cell component is recorded as cytosol[22].
- RNA polymerase I and III subunit C's cell component is recorded as nucleoplasm[23].
- RNA polymerase I and III subunit C's cell component is recorded as RNA polymerase III complex[24].
- RNA polymerase I and III subunit C's cell component is recorded as nucleus[25].
- RNA polymerase I and III subunit C's cell component is recorded as RNA polymerase I complex[26].
